Project Overview

• What is the project about?o To redesign the library’s staff intranet, in

order to:

• provide a more efficient intranet • improve communication• add a search capability• reduce e-mail overload• enhance positive user experience

• Project goalo To build a Drupal intranet that replaces the

current staff intranet

• Project scopeo In-house design and development that utilizes

staff time, tools, and resources available in the

library

Report 2: Site Inventory

• Information Architecture and Navigation Systemo inventory all the existing pages and associated files using a

Google Docs Spreadsheet

o distinguish the characteristics of each file to determine logical

groupings

o identify duplicated pages by content creators/reviewers

o exclude pages that are no longer needed by content

creators/reviewers

Report 6: Site Mockup

• Technology tools/application:o Adobe Fireworks- images

o Adobe Dreamweaver- webpages and navigation design

o feed2js.com- RSS feed content (http://feed2js.org/)

o Google Calendar- upcoming birthdays

o Google Customized Search- site search

o Google Forms- surveys

• Some other resources:o Xmind.com- sitemap (http://www.xmind.net/)

o Gliffy- flowchart (http://www.gliffy.com/)

Current Status

• The project is currently delayed…

• What issues have risen?

• Difficult to categorize some groups; for example:

“Library Senator”, “task force”, “Future of the

Library discussion group”, “Distance Learning

Services”, “Instructional Services”, etc.

• Drupal authority and learning curves

• Time management

• Other issues

Looking Ahead

• When is the next milestone?o Migrate the site in late 2011 and/or early

2012

o Train staff – the content providers such as

department heads, committee chairs- for

using the new Drupal site

• Known risks and issueso Lack of sufficient knowledge in using Drupal

o Depends mainly on one student employee

o Time management skill

o Unseen reasons
